  4. Há 5 dias · The Bundestag is the lower house, representing the nation as a whole and elected by universal suffrage under a system of mixed direct and proportional representation. Members serve four-year terms. The Bundestag in turn elects the chancellor (prime minister), who is the head of government .

  7. 12 de abr. de 2024 · The House of Commons Parliamentary Papers online is a searchable full text data base of the working papers of the House of Commons from 1715 to present. These are papers created by the Commons and also those presented to it. They include bills, parliamentary committee reports and evidence, reports of royal commissions, and command papers.
